What 9mm Edge Banding Should You Use?390
Edge banding is a thin strip of wood, plastic, or other material that is applied to the exposed edges of plywood, particleboard, or other wood products. It serves several purposes, including:
Protecting the exposed edge from wear and tear
Improving the appearance of the finished product
Hiding the raw materials used in the construction of the product
When choosing edge banding for use on 9mm plywood or particleboard, there are a few things to consider:
Material
Edge banding can be made from a variety of materials, including:
Wood: Wood edge banding is the most traditional type and comes in a variety of species, colors, and finishes.
Plastic: Plastic edge banding is less expensive than wood edge banding and is available in a wide range of colors and patterns.
Metal: Metal edge banding is more durable than wood or plastic edge banding, but it is also more expensive.
Thickness
Edge banding is available in a variety of thicknesses, but the most common thickness for 9mm plywood or particleboard is 0.5mm or 1mm. A thicker edge banding can provide more protection, but it can also make the finished product look bulkier.
Adhesive
Edge banding can be applied with a variety of adhesives, including:
Hot melt adhesive: Hot melt adhesive is applied to the edge of the banding and then melted to bond it to the substrate.
Contact adhesive: Contact adhesive is applied to both the edge of the banding and the substrate and then the two surfaces are pressed together to bond them.
Pressure-sensitive adhesive: Pressure-sensitive adhesive is applied to the back of the banding and then the banding is pressed onto the substrate.
The type of adhesive you choose will depend on the materials you are using and the desired level of bond strength.
Application
Edge banding can be applied by hand or by machine. If you are applying edge banding by hand, you will need to use a sharp utility knife to cut the banding to length and then use a hot iron or a heat gun to melt the adhesive and bond the banding to the substrate. If you are applying edge banding by machine, you will need to use a specialized edge banding machine.
Once you have considered all of these factors, you can choose the right edge banding for your 9mm plywood or particleboard project.
Additional Tips
Here are a few additional tips for choosing and applying edge banding:
Always test the edge banding on a scrap piece of material before applying it to your project.
Use a sharp utility knife to cut the edge banding to length.
Apply the adhesive evenly to both the edge of the banding and the substrate.
Press the banding onto the substrate firmly and hold it in place until the adhesive has dried or cured.
If you are using a hot melt adhesive, be careful not to overheat the adhesive, as this can cause the adhesive to lose its bond strength.
With a little care and attention, you can achieve professional-looking results when applying edge banding to your 9mm plywood or particleboard project.
